In the book of Exodus, the LORD (Yahweh) displayed His awesome power and almighty hand through signs and wonders, so that the evil Pharaoh would know that the God of the Hebrews is the only true King and God of heaven and earth. Moses and Aaron repeatedly went to the wicked Pharaoh, who was the king of Egypt, to demand that Pharaoh release and free the Israelites (Hebrews) from slavery, or Pharaoh would experience God’s wrath and punishment. The evil Pharaoh became more and more defiant against the living Sovereign LORD God and his servants Moses and Aaron, and refused to release the Israelites from their brutal slavery. Even more, the evil Pharaoh increased the Israelites’ labor and made them work even harder. The evil Pharaoh and his taskmasters and overseers continued to beat and demand that the Hebrews continue their heavy labor building Pithom and Raamses for Egypt, while also accusing the Israelites of being weak and lazy, who did not want to work.
Therefore, the living Sovereign LORD God of heaven and earth demonstrated His mighty power to the evil Pharaoh and the Egyptians through signs and wonders, as He sent ten plagues. These divine plagues were unprecedented in the history of Egypt. The plagues of Egypt are often called “signs,” just as Christ Jesus’s miracles in the New Testament were called “signs” as Christ Jesus’ ministry was filled with divine signs and mighty deeds. The Holy Bible warns that Satan and his evil workers, who are filled with lies, darkness, and greed, can also perform signs and wonders to lead people away from wholehearted faithfulness and allegiance to the living Sovereign LORD God. In the book of Exodus, the evil Pharaoh’s magicians and sorcerers performed similar signs and wonders as Moses and his brother Aaron, but God’s power defeated and overpowered these evil demons' signs and wonders. The evil Pharaoh’s magicians realized they had no true power, and the plagues were the “finger of God.”
In the first plague, the living Sovereign LORD God, through His servant Moses, turned all the waters into blood, including the canals, ponds, and rivers of Egypt, as well as the Egyptian Nile. Then, the living Sovereign LORD God released frogs throughout the whole land of Egypt. However, the evil Pharaoh refused to submit and obey the LORD (Yahweh). So, the living Sovereign LORD God sent more plagues throughout Egypt including pesky gnats and swarming flies, turning all the animals and livestock of Egypt sick, giving the Egyptians and the animals festering skin boils with painful sores, bringing destroying hailstorms with thunder and lightning flashes, and then He sent swarms of locusts (grasshoppers) throughout Egypt that ate all the Egyptians crops leaving Egypt in devastation and ruins.
With the divine plagues, the evil Pharaoh begged Moses to intercede and pray to the living Sovereign LORD God to take God’s punishment and wrath away from Egypt, and then he would release Israel from slavery. So, the living Sovereign LORD God listened to Moses’ prayers and removed the plagues from the land of Egypt. Sometime later, the living Sovereign LORD God sent the ninth plague of darkness, bringing complete darkness over all of Egypt so that the evil Pharaoh would release Israel from slavery. After feeling the darkness, the evil Pharaoh agreed to release the Israelites from slavery, but once again, the wicked Pharaoh lied and refused to submit to the LORD (Yahweh) by releasing Israel from slavery. Then, the living Sovereign LORD God sent His tenth plague and final angry blow upon Egypt by destroying and killing all the Egyptians' firstborn sons living in every family, including Pharaoh’s firstborn son, and killing the firstborn of all the Egyptian male animals and livestock. The living Sovereign LORD God’s tenth and final plague was to strike and execute judgment against all the gods of Egypt so the Egyptians would know the LORD (Yahweh) is the only true God of heaven and earth. However, the living Sovereign LORD God announced to the evil Pharaoh that there would be peace and safety over God’s people.
Finally, the evil Pharaoh released the Israelites from slavery after experiencing the strong wrath and mighty power of the living Sovereign LORD God, so Israel could worship the LORD (Yahweh). The evil Pharaoh released the Israelites from slavery, and Moses led the Israelites out of Egypt as a strong and great army, with the living Sovereign LORD God as Israel’s Commander-in-Chief leading the way through His Glory Cloud—a fiery cloud that provided protection and guidance to Israel. The Israelites endured 430 years of brutal slavery and oppression as the living Sovereign LORD God warned Abraham in Genesis 15, so Israel would receive the Promised Land of God - Israel-Palestine, which flows with milk and honey, that He promised Abraham, Isaac, and Jacob. Even more, the living Sovereign LORD God gave His people favor amongst the Egyptians, and Israel plundered and stripped the Egyptians of their wealth as they were leaving slavery.
From the events of Exodus, the living Sovereign LORD God established the beginning of the New Year (Abib, later called by the Babylonians Nisan), the LORD’s Passover celebration meal of the spotless Passover animal (lamb or goat), and the Festival of Unleavened Bread (celebration of seven days eating bread without yeast). The living Sovereign LORD God commanded the Israelites to take some of the Passover animal’s blood and smear it over their home’s doorframe, and then He would pass over their home during His final plague of death. Thus, the Passover meal and the Festival of Unleavened Bread are annual spring festivals that celebrate God’s eternal laws, marking the living Sovereign LORD God’s redemption and deliverance of His people, Israel, from the evil of Egyptian slavery and death.
The New Testament states that Christ Jesus celebrated the annual Jewish Passover during His public ministry on earth. Notably, Christ Jesus’ sacrificial death and resurrection are closely linked in the New Testament to the Passover season. Christ Jesus’ last supper with His disciples on Thursday evening before His sacrificial death at Calvary on Friday was the Passover meal celebration (Seder meal). Christ Jesus is the sacrificial Passover Lamb of God, who gave His spotless life as a ransom Passover Lamb, to redeem and free everyone through faithful obedience to Him from Satan’s evil bondage and bring us into God’s Kingdom family and new life. In fact, the Apostle Paul in the New Testament draws a comparison between the Passover of the Exodus and the sacrifice of Christ Jesus our Lord, to be celebrated with sincerity and truth. In essence, Christ Jesus’s sacrificial death transformed the traditional annual Passover with reference to His own sacrificial death as the Passover Lamb of God.
